On spun-normal and twisted squares surfaces

Given a 3 manifold M with torus boundary and an ideal triangulation, Yoshida and Tillmann give different methods to construct surfaces embedded in M from ideal points of the deformation variety. Yoshida builds a surface from twisted squares whereas Tillmann produces a spun-normal surface. We investigate the relation between the generated surfaces and extend a result of Tillmann's (that if the ideal point of the deformation variety corresponds to an ideal point of the character variety then the generated spun-normal surface is detected by the character variety) to the generated twisted squares surfaces.
